Home Renovation FAQs

What’s the difference between home renovations and home remodeling?

Home renovations focus on updating and refreshing existing spaces — new flooring, custom millwork, paint, trim, and architectural details — without changing the layout or removing walls. Home remodeling involves structural changes like wall removal, floor plan reconfiguration, and major mechanical upgrades. Think of renovation as a facelift and remodeling as reconstructive surgery. Both improve your home, but renovations are less disruptive, faster, and typically more affordable. How much do interior renovations typically cost in Nassau County?

Home renovation costs vary widely based on what’s involved. A single room with new flooring, paint, and basic trim work might run $5,000 to $10,000. Adding custom millwork like wainscoting, built-in shelving, or a fireplace surround adds $3,000 to $8,000 per room depending on complexity. Whole-house flooring and painting projects can range from $15,000 to $30,000+. How long does an interior renovation take?

A single room renovation — flooring, paint, and trim — typically takes 1 to 2 weeks. Adding custom millwork extends the timeline to 2 to 3 weeks per room. A whole-house renovation with flooring, painting, and millwork across multiple rooms can take 4 to 8 weeks depending on scope. Renovations are generally much faster than remodeling projects because they don’t involve structural changes, permit approvals, or mechanical rough-ins. Do interior renovations need permits in Nassau County?

Most interior renovations — flooring, paint, trim, and millwork — do not require building permits in Nassau County. Permits are typically only needed when the work involves structural changes, electrical modifications, or plumbing relocation. Since home renovations focus on cosmetic and finish work rather than structural or mechanical changes, you can usually start sooner and avoid the 2-4 week permit approval timeline. Can you match the existing trim in my older Nassau County home?

Yes — matching existing trim profiles is one of Kevin’s specialties. Nassau County’s post-war homes were built with specific molding profiles that are often no longer available at standard lumber yards. Kevin can identify the profile, source matching stock, or mill custom pieces so new trim work blends seamlessly with the original. This matters because mismatched trim is immediately noticeable — it makes new work look like an afterthought. When we add millwork to an older home, it should look like it was always there.
